- TYTAN™ titanates strongly improve adhesion to metallic substrates through covalent bonding, cross-linking the functional groups of a wide variety of resin binders and acting as coupling agents for pigments and fillers. This allows formulators to develop coatings for a wide variety of binder systems that have the necessary adhesion and anti-corrosive properties to withstand the toughest requirements of today's general industrial, chemical and transport industries.
- For ambient cure coatings heat resistance can be improved to withstand temperatures of 250°C. For baked coatings the TYTAN™ products will both engage in additional cross-linking and also have a catalyzing effect on the cross-linking of the resin, resulting in coatings that can resist temperatures of up to 650°C. TYTAN™ Organo-Titanates are particularly suitable for improving the properties of coatings with silicone based binders, due to the synergistic chemistry of titanates and silicones.
